City regulations on dumpster rental in Hackensack

Most cities or municipalities don't have many regulations regarding dumpster rental in Hackensack as long as you keep the dumpster totally on your own property during the rental period. If you have to place your container on the street at all, you will probably have to get a permit from the right building permit office in your town.

Most dumpster rental businesses in Hackensack will take care of procuring this permit for you if you rent from them. Be sure that in case you're planning to set the dumpster on the street, the business has made the proper arrangements. You must also make sure that you get the permit in a timely manner and at the right cost. In case you believed the dumpster business was getting a permit and they didn't, you will be the person who will have to pay the fine that's issued by the authorities.

Paying for your dumpster

If you would like to rent a dumpster in Hackensack, you will discover that costs vary substantially from state to state and city to city. One way to get genuine quotes for the service you need is to call a local dumpster business and ask regarding their costs. You can also request a quote online on some websites. These websites may also include full online service that is constantly open. On these websites, you can choose, schedule and pay for your service whenever it's suitable for you.

Variables that affect the cost of the container include landfill fees (higher in certain places than others) and the size of the container you choose. You should also consider transportation costs and the type of debris you'll be placing into your container.

Price quotes for dumpster rental in Hackensack generally include the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base cost for the dumpster, how much weight is contained in the estimate, a specified rental period and delivery and pickup fees.

How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, as long as you don't load it higher compared to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are not really safe, and businesses will not take unsafe loads to be able to protect drivers and passengers on the road.

In some areas,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. If your load is too high, it will not be able to be tarped so you'll have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This may result in additional fees if it requires you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Don't forget to maintain your load no higher compared to the sides of the dumpster, and you'll be fine.

Common items to put in a roll-off dumpster

When you rent a roll-off dumpster, you will be tempted to throw anything and everything inside. Common things which individuals typically dispose of in a dumpster include solid waste material and most routine home and building waste, along with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They are able to be used for company and commercial cleanouts, home renovations, getting cleared of junk when you are moving to a new house, bigger landscaping jobs and more.

A record of things you cannot place in a roll-off dumpster comprises pa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ronic equipment and batteries. If you try and contain these items, you will probably end up with an additional fee. Other things which will definitely inc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Additional heavy stuff are also not enabled; items that are too hefty may surpass government transport regulations and be unsafe to haul.


Do you know the Various Sizes of Dumpsters Available?

Depending on the size of your endeavor, you might need a small or large dumpster that may hold all of the debris and left over stuff.

Dumpster rental firms usually provide several sizes for people and companies. Deciding on the best size should assist you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most frequent dumpsters comprise 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. For those who are in possession of a little endeavor, for example cl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. For those who have a bigger endeavor, for example a complete remodel or building a brand new home, then you will lik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

Lots of folks decide to rent a bigger dumpster than they believe they'll want. Although renting a bigger dumpster prices more cash, it's cheaper than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ets full.

Terms to know when renting a dumpster in Hackensack

When you rent a dumpster in Hackensack, you are d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you probably do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can really assist you to deal with company employees who may get impatient should you not understand what they're explaining about their products.

"Container" and "roll off" are both satisfactory terms for the large metal box you want to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ually rented in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to comprise the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for example, you wish to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you can say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you're going to seem like a pro when you call.
